26 Oct 2009A little bit about Graffiti Zoo:
Graffiti Zoo chocolates are handmade in small batches, using only the freshest of ingredients and most unusual flavor combinations, to create an unforgettable chocolate experience! As a responsible company to the communities it serves they believe in giving something back as well. So, in keeping with their love of animals, Graffiti Zoo donates a portion of proceeds from every sale to the Conservation Endowment Fund of the American Zoo & Aquarium.
The Graffiti Zoo collection includes an array of intriquing flavors such as Almond Armadillos (crunch milk chocolate with a dash of amaretto), Bohemian Tree Frogs (milk chocolate, raspberries and toasted almonds), Barking Dogs (milk chocolate, butter crunch toffee with roasted almonds), Island Dragonflies (dark chocolate and tangerine), Zanzibar Racing Snails (dark chocolate, cranberries and roasted almonds topped with sea salt and sugar crystals), Margarita Manitee (white chocolate and key lime), and Pink Flamingos (milk chocolate, cherries and coconut). Most chocolate items are available in .9 oz mini-view packaging ($1.99) 2.4 oz. side view packaging ($3.99) or 4.5 oz. gift box packaging ($7.00). The company is also debuting a delectable new cookie creation, Trinidad Sea Turtles (ginger snaps drenched in creamy white chocolate infused with the zest of sun ripened lemons). Graffiti Zoo sweets are ideal for gift giving as well with specially packaged gift boxes, tins and baskets. Graffiti Zoo sent me their Barking Dogs chocolate to review. The Barking Dogs are Butter Crunch Toffee with Roasted Almonds surrounded with Milk Chocolate. Mmmm… they are crunchy, nutty, and perfectly delicious! I love that Graffiti Zoo *really* goes the extra mile to make sure that your order arrives in perfect condition. They first pack your order in a hot/cold bag (these bags are not cheap! I saw one at the store yesterday for $3.99!) and then they pack at least 2 ice packs (also not cheap) along with it, depending on the size of your order.
